In a deposition made by JULES ENDLER, 188 Elmwood Drive,
Orange, New Jersey, at the Doctor's Hospital, East S7th and East
End Avenues, New York City, on September 16, 1954, he stated he hati
known ABNER ZWILLMAN since 1940. It was pointed out to ENDLER
that on November 10, 1948, he, ENDLER, made a statement to the
Treasury Department in which he stated "I never have been a partner
of Mr. Zwillman's nor am I now a partner of his. We each had a
minority participation in certain transactions". ENDLER then
described these transactions as follows:
1) Stock participation in Manhattan Productions
Inc. in 1944,
ENDLER stated ZWILLMAN, JEROME L. SILVERMAN, and himself
each bought $600 worth of stock in above company and subsequmtly
each leaned around $25,000 to the company. ENDLER recalled
ZWILLMAN's loan as having been made in currency.
2) Subsequently, funds of Manhattan Productions
Inc. were transferred to Greentree Productions,
Inc. and additional funds were put up.
ENDLER said ZWILLMAN put up $35,000 for participation
in stock and other loans were made for the purpose of a completion
bond which figures he did not recall.
3) Bal Roach Studios in Los Angeles, California,
1044 or 1945.
ENDLER said arrangenents were made te purchase this
studio for $1,000,000, of which $50,000 was neceasary in cash.
ENDLER said ZWILLMAN, SILVERNAN, and himself each put up one-third
and recalled ZWILLMAN's share as having been furnished in currency.
ENDLER said it was later determined there was no equipment
in this studio and the serey was refunded a few days later.
